Pardalotes or peep-wrens are a family, Pardalotidae, of very small, brightly coloured birds native to Australia, with short tails, strong legs, and stubby blunt beaks. This family is composed of four species in one genus, Pardalotus, and several subspecies. The name derives from a Greek word meaning "spotted". The family once contained several other species now split into the family Acanthizidae.

Pardalotes spend most of their time high in the outer foliage of trees, feeding on insects, spiders, and above all lerps (a type of sap-sucking insect). Their role in controlling lerp infestations in the eucalyptus forests of Australia may be significant. They generally live in pairs in small tunnels or in small family groups but sometimes come together into flocks after breeding.

Pardalotes are seasonal breeders in temperate areas of Australia but may breed year round in warmer areas. They are monogamous breeders, and both partners share nest construction, incubation and chick-rearing duties. All four species nest in deep horizontal tunnels drilled into banks of earth. Externally about the size of a mouse-hole, they can be very deep, at a metre or more. Some species also nest in tree hollows.

Taxonomy and systematics

The genus Pardalotus was introduced in 1816 by the French ornithologist Louis Pierre Vieillot to accommodate a single species, the spotted pardalote, which is therefore considered as the type species. The genus name is from Ancient Greek pardalōtos meaning "spotted like a leopard". The family Pardalotidae (as a subfamily Pardalotinae) was introduced in 1842 by the English naturalist Hugh Strickland.

The pardalotes consist of several species contained in a single genus, Pardalotus, with the general consensus being to recognise four species. The placement of the genus has varied, being first placed with the mostly oriental flowerpeckers (Dicaeidae), as both groups are dumpy-looking birds with bright plumage. In addition both groups have a reduced tenth primary (one of the flight feathers). Genetic analysis has shown that the two groups are in fact not closely related, and that the pardalotes are instead more closely related another Australian family, the Acanthizidae, which includes the scrubwrens, gerygones and thornbills. The two are sometimes merged into one family; when this is done the combined family is known as Pardalotidae, but the two groups have also been treated as two separate families. which are sometimes elevated to four separate species. The spotted pardalote has three subspecies, one of which—the yellow-rumped pardalote—is sometimes treated as a separate species due to its distinctive plumage and call and lack of zone of hybridization in southwestern Australia. Within the family the relationships between the subspecies are unclear, although it is thought that the forty-spotted pardalote is closely related to the spotted pardalote. They feed singly or in pairs during the breeding season, but have been recorded as joining mixed-species feeding flocks in the winter months. The majority of foraging occurs on Eucalyptus, with other trees being used much less frequently; among the eucalyptus, trees from the subgenus Symphyomyrtus are preferred. Pardalotes forage by gleaning insects from the foliage, as opposed to catching insects while flying. Pardalotes may consume a number of different types of insects, but lerps – a honeydew casing exuded by insects of the family Psyllidae – form the major component of their diet and the one to which they are most adapted. These lerps are also highly sought after by the larger honeyeaters, which aggressively defend the resource. A study of pardalotes in Australia estimated that 5% of a pardalote's day is spent evading honeyeater attacks.

Movements

Patterns of dispersal include regular winter movements northwards and to lower altitudes. Striated Pardalotes migrate from Tasmania across Bass Strait to winter on the Australian mainland. Spotted and Striated Pardalotes move from higher altitude forests to lower rainfall inland plains in SE Australia. Spotted and Striated Pardalotes also move intermittently following increases in psyllids food sources. Some Pardalote populations are sedentary. Forty-spotted Pardalotes are probably sedentary with local seasonal movements restricted to eastern Tasmania and its adjacent islands. Movements of Red-browed Pardalotes are unknown.

Status and conservation threats

The Striated, Spotted and Red-browed Pardalotes are widespread and common but their populations are decreasing due to habitat loss. Land clearing and commercial forestry in native eucalypt forests results in the loss of foraging habitat, nesting hollows and forest linkages essential for dispersal. The Forty-spotted Pardalote is listed as Endangered by the IUCN and under Australian legislation. The distribution of the Forty-spotted Pardalote is restricted to a narrow habitat range and the population is small and fragmented. Threats include habitat loss, competition with colonial honeyeaters, especially the Noisy Miner, and parasitism. The Tasmanian ectoparasite, Passeromyia longicornis demonstrates a higher parasite load and virulence with high nestling mortality in Forty-spotted Pardalote nests compared to Striated Pardalotes. Over the 2-year study by Edworthy et al., Forty-spotted Pardalotes fledged fewer nestlings (18%) than sympatric Striated Pardalotes (26%). Climate change effects are uncertain but anticipated. Reductions in the distribution of the Striated Pardalote in the Western Australian wheatbelt are predicted due to climate change.
